Introduction
High-performance Embedded Microcontroller for automotive and industrial applications
Product Features and Performance
ARM Cortex-M4F Core Processor
32-Bit Single-Core architecture
Speed of 80MHz
Rich set of connectivity options including CANbus, FlexIO, I2C, LINbus, SPI, UART/USART
Advanced peripherals including POR, PWM, WDT
89 Input/Output pins available
Large program memory of 1MB (1M x 8) FLASH
EEPROM Size of 4K x 8
RAM Size of 128K x 8 for robust applications
Internal oscillator for system clock
Robust operating temperature range from -40°C to 105°C
Surface Mount 100-LQFP (14x14) package for compact design

Key Technical Parameters
Core Size: 32-Bit Single-Core
Speed: 80MHz
Program Memory Size: 1MB FLASH
EEPROM Size: 4K x 8
RAM Size: 128K x 8
Voltage Supply Range: 2.7V ~ 5.5V
A/D Converters: 24x12b SAR
D/A Converter: 1x8b
Operating Temperature: -40°C ~ 105°C
Mounting Type: Surface Mount
Supplier Device Package: 100-LQFP
